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Nuneaton to Dewsbury start from as little as £20.90

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Nuneaton to Dewsbury start from £47.60 one way, or £86.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Nuneaton to Dewsbury are available for £78.40 one way, or £176.10 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ility at Nuneaton

Nuneaton Station opens its doors early and closes late, making it highly accessible for a variety of travel schedules. The ticket office operates Monday to Saturday from 6:00 AM to 8:00 PM, extending hours slightly on Sunday from 9:00 AM to 9:00 PM. For those who prefer not to queue, ticket machines are readily available, and online ticket collections can be made at these machines as well. The station is designed with accessibility in mind, offering step-free access throughout. You'll find accessible ticket machines, ramps for train access, and toilets, including baby changing facilities. While there are seating areas available, it's worth noting there isn't a designated waiting room or a 1st class lounge.

Parking and Additional Amenities

Driving to the station? Worry not—Nuneaton Station provides extensive parking facilities operated by SABA UK, open 24 hours throughout the week. There are 193 spaces, including seven accessible ones. Payment can be made via the SABA Parking app or website, with options for daily, weekly, monthly, and annual rates. Although the station doesn't host ATMs or shops, there is a buffet service available for those quick bites on the go. Also, CCTV surveillance ensures security is a station priority, giving peace of mind to those parking their vehicles onsite.

Facilities at Dewsbury Train Station

Dewsbury train station is well-equipped to ensure a smooth and comfortable journey. The station's ticket office is open every day, making it easy for passengers to buy or collect their tickets. Automated ticket machines offer an additional option for those in a hurry and are accessible for all users, including those needing additional support. Furthermore, induction loops are available to assist passengers with hearing impairments.

Accessibility is a notable feature at Dewsbury, with step-free access throughout the station. This includes ramps for easy boarding and heated waiting rooms for comfort, especially during the colder months. While the station provides ample seating and wheelchair availability, the absence of luggage storage facilities means travelers might need to plan accordingly. The West Riding public house offers refreshments for those in need of a drink or a bite. Free car parking is another added convenience, with the station's car park being monitored by CCTV.
